DUSHANBE, June 17, 2013, Asia-Plus -- On Monday June 17, Tajik President Emomali Rahmon sent a message of congratulations to Hassan Rouhani on his election as the President of the Islamic Republic of Iran.
In his congratulatory message, President Rahmon, in particular, said that Tajikistan attached significance to development of its relations with Iran and expressed hope for further expansion of bilateral mutually beneficial cooperation between the two countries.
Noting that Tajikistan and Iran share a common history, culture and language, President Rahmon wished peace and wellbeing to the people of Iran.
We will recall that Hassan Rouhani won the presidential election in the Islamic Republic of Iran that took place on June 14. 72% of 50 million eligible Iranians reportedly voted, and Rouhani won just over the 50% of the vote required to avoid a runoff.
